At the time, what was the value of the 78 CC? Before the hoard was released, it may have been one of the more common CCMorgans on the market. I'm leaning towards MS61.
CDN listing for BU 1963 $8.50 (This was while the Treasury was still hand out filver dollars for face value) 1964 $8.00 1965 $8.00 1966 $7.25 1967 $9.00 1968 $12.50 1969 $12.00 1970 $13.50 1971 $14.50 (This is the year before the first GSA sales) 1972 $16.50 1973 $20.00 1974 $27.50 1975 $29.00 1976 $27.00 1977 $38.00 1978 $76.00 1979 $150.00 1980 $125.00 1981 $130.00 1982 $135.00 1983 $145.00 1984 $142.50 1985 $200.00 1986 $200.00 (PCGS begins) 1987 $190.00 (NGC begins) 1988 $140.00 (PCGS) $150.00 (NGC) $150.00 (ANACS)
